Urine Alcohol Testing

Urine alcohol testing is a common method to detect recent alcohol consumption. This non-invasive test measures the presence of ethanol in the urine, indicating alcohol use within the past few hours to days. It's especially useful for situations requiring verification of blood alcohol levels in Riverside, Utah and beyond.

Hair Alcohol Testing

Hair alcohol testing provides a long-term view of alcohol consumption patterns, detecting usage over a 90-day period. In Riverside, Utah, it is prized for its ability to uncover habitual alcohol use. Examining ethyl glucuronide (ETG) in hair samples allows for thorough assessment of alcohol patterns during specified timeframes.

Blood Alcohol Testing

Blood alcohol testing measures the exact amount of alcohol present in the bloodstream at the time of the test. Known for its high accuracy and reliability, it provides legal standard results. Blood tests are often used in medical and legal settings, ensuring comprehensive and detailed insights into alcohol levels.

Breath Alcohol Testing

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T) is a quick method used to estimate blood alcohol content by analyzing breath samples. In Riverside, Utah, it is favored for roadside tests and screenings due to its non-invasive nature. It offers immediate results and is regularly used by law enforcement and employers for efficient alcohol detection.

ETG/ETS Alcohol Testing

ETG/ETS alcohol testing identifies ethyl glucuronide in urine, a direct biomarker for alcohol consumption. Perfect for identifying even negligible amounts of alcohol, it's widely used for zero-tolerance programs in Riverside, Utah, offering a substantial detection period post-consumption.

Breath alcohol testing is commonly used for both DOT and non-DOT workplace compliance because it can document an exact alcohol concentration.
Alcohol testing is frequently required after a workplace accident, when there is reasonable suspicion of on-duty impairment, before an employee returns to duty after an alcohol policy violation, as part of random testing pools for regulated safety-sensitive positions, and for court, probation, or program compliance.
Breath alcohol testing can generate an immediate reading of alcohol concentration and, in the case of evidential breath testing, produce a documented result that can be used to support policy action or regulatory compliance. Saliva screening can also provide rapid indication of alcohol presence.
